初涉专题

初涉opencv——opencv安装问题

由于研究需要,开始学习opencv。opencv即一个视觉代码库,可供用户免费使用。       测试过程中出现了一些问题,有两位大神的博客给我很大的启发和帮助。供自己使用和后来者参考。       http://wiki.opencv.org.cn/index.php/VC_2010下安装OpenCV2.4.4,这个比较安装步骤详细,    文章链接: http://b

初涉Kotlin

kotlin官网链接: http://kotlinlang.org/  Kotlin是一门与Swift类似的静态类型JVM语言,由JetBrains设计开发并开源。与Java相比,Kotlin的语法更简洁、更具表达性,而且提供了更多的特性,比如,高阶函数、操作符重载、字符串模板。它与Java高度可互操作,可以同时用在一个项目中。 按照JetBrains的说法,根据他们多年的Jav

CSS初涉

为什么会有CSS?        之前仅仅通过HTML来控制页面显示时,例如改变颜色:修改样式颜色时候只能通过对每一个标签进行修改来进行。为了改进这种繁杂的操作,引入了CSS层叠样式表从而分离了页面内容以及页面显示设置。 <h2><font color=”#0000EF” face=”黑体”>CSS学习</font></h2>          下面通过使用C

初涉LeNet5处理mnist (CNN卷积神经网络)

import tensorflow as tffrom tensorflow.examples.tutorials.mnist import input_dataimport osimport numpy as np#输入节点个数INPUT_NODE = 784#输出节点个数OUTPUT_NODE = 10#图片的尺寸IMAGE_SIZE = 28#通道数NUM_CHANNE

【大话设计模式】--初涉设计模式

在结束完机房之后,到现在的很长一段时间没有敲代码,看着十期他们天天看牛腩,敲代码,调试,而且还用着 自 己 不懂的语言,感觉可羡慕了。在学习C#的时候其实可带劲了,可是新语言接受起来也不是那么容易的。 在完成C#视频之后进行的大话设计,感觉原来同一个东西原来还可以用这么多种方法表示,原来按照这种模式设 计 出来的东东这么方 便的!下面说说刚接触大话的一点点小收获,如果

JAVA学习日记初涉SWING

在读完SWING 这章后,自己交的作业 具体实现以上布局 ,练习了一些SWING语句 以下代码: import java.awt.*; import javax.swing.*; import java.awt.event.*; public class MyDialog extends JFrame { public MyDialog(){     String

初涉linux命令查看服务器中运行代码

使用软件:putty.exe 1.cat命令查看 例如:cat /ftp/www/........... 2.vim命令修改 3.查看某一特定文件,如:index.html 例如:find / -name index.html

Log4Net初涉-第一个案例

Log4Net的第一个案例 刚开始接触C#一些关键的技术,目前参与的项目中使用到了Log4Net这一个优秀的日志工具,因为以前没有接触过,就把第一次搭建案例的步骤记录下来,与大家分享: Log4Net的简单介绍Log4Net的下载具体案例总结一下 Log4Net的简单介绍 [log4net](http://baike.baidu.com/link?url=uJHeV_eY0Ee

初涉USB,初学者USB入门总结(5)USB上位机读写开发

上一部分说了固件和驱动的编程,这里再谈一下上位机的程序,因为我开发的范围也就是传传数据,所以太深入的没有去做,不过一般的工程调试应该足够了。     固件的程序和驱动编写好了后,把设备插入就可以正确识别到,接下来的工作就是如何用上位机读写设备了。其实读写操作跟读写串口一致的,就是用file进行操作。关键是打开设备,下面是我用到的程序,这里都贴出来吧,我都是用这个的,供大家参考,呵呵,如果刚开始弄

初涉USB,初学者USB入门总结4,USB通讯设备快速开发

经过上述三节的描述,对USB应该已经有了初步的认识,其中具体的协议(比如各个描述符的定义什么的)这里不做描述了,网上一搜一大堆。下面我以一个实例来详细说明快速开发USB设备的步骤, 一,设定规划 凡事预则立,不预则费,所以开发一个小小的USB也要稍微规划一下,比如想象要实现什么功能,传输的数据协议什么的。 二,固件编程, 固件编程说白了就是写单片机程序,要实现USB一般可以使用带USB功能的单片

初涉USB,初学者USB入门总结(3) 数据包阐述

对于USB传输大体有个概念,下一步就来看看到底USB上传的什么东西,以什么格式传数据,先不涉及端点的概念。 各种总线的数据传输都是以固定的层次协议进行的,USB当然也不例外。所谓的层次也只是个抽象的概念罢了,就是表达一种依附关系,上层要依赖与底层,上层以底层为基础,上层只需要关心自己的东西就行了,如果你还不明白,那就继续看,学习一个东西不可能一两句话说的明白一个点,需要全面了解后才能清楚各个点。

初涉USB,初学者USB入门总结(2) 设备固件程序

为了更好的说明整个USB启动过程,我们可以用串口实时的跟踪各个USB中断。不过这里先不用串口进行测试,只是简单的用一组变量记录过程。测试程序如下(以下会有程序的说明):    uchar test[100];//100长度的变量,记录过程 uchar conters=0;//记录计数值, /*----------------------------------------------------

初涉USB,初学者USB入门总结(1)枚举

一,概述 现在很多的主控上都带有USB的功能,但是对于初学者来说,这方面应用还是比较棘手,因为usb的不但固件程序需要编写,PC端的驱动也要编写,而且驱动写好了还要写个上位机才能看出效果。这样调试起来十分困难,建议从USB的键盘,鼠标开始做,了解清楚了,再做自己的协议就比较简单了。 USB的概念历史啥的这里就不说了。我们先不管具体的数据包格式,这一节先从整个包的层面上简单的说,过程是这样的,

Webservice-初涉(一)

简介 Webservice,从表面上看,Web service就是一个应用程序,它向外界暴露出一个能够通过Web进行调用的API。这就是说,你能够用编程的方法通过Web来调用这个应用程序。用很通俗的话说,就是把两个系统需要交互,webService就为这种跨平台的可操作性提供了技术可行性,因此,WebService完全基于XML、XSD。使用WebService有很多好处:跨防火墙的通信、应

初涉莫比乌斯反演

预备知识 数论分块:莫比乌斯函数: 莫比乌斯反演例题 BZOJ2301BZOJ1101LUOGU2257BZOJ2005 今天我们来讨论莫比乌斯反演。我承认,反演这个东西对于数学不好的人来说确实很痛苦(比如我)。但是真正学透了,还是会发现这个东西非常巧妙。 预备知识 数论分块: 关于数论分块,我写过一篇博客,也介绍了一些例题,这里再做一个简介。 比

初涉JavaScript模式 (9) : 函数 【常用方式】

回调模式 上一篇,对JavaScript函数进行了大体的介绍,这一篇对一些在工作中经常遇到的情况进行扩展。 在工作中,我们经常遇到很多需求,比如现在有一个需求: 一栋10层的大楼,当我们在坐电梯时,电梯每上一层,每层的电梯显示屏上即时显示电梯当前所在的楼层。 这样我们可能不到1s,就想到了解决方案,只要电梯每上一层,把每一层的电梯显示屏数字 +1 ,代码核心如下: ```javascriptfu

问鼎OSPF(2)-初涉路由显神通,治军四方拥

问鼎OSPF 一、访诸葛三顾茅庐 论运行机制谋治世妙法1、Hello协议交互-形成邻居关系2、LSAs的泛洪-通告链路状态信息3、LSDB的组建-形成带权有向图4、SPF的计算-形成路由5、路由表的维护更新 二、领虎符整饬三军,设RouterID知己知彼三、因地域分四路掠城,携天威攻万变贼寇1、广播(`Broadcast`)类型2、`NBMA`(`Non-Broadcast Multi-Ac

Mondrian初涉入门--运行自带演示程序FoodMart配置步骤

最近刚接触Mondrian,准备学习这个强大的开源Olap工具,首先从它自带的demo例子程序学起,下面将在windows平台给出几种连接数据库(odbc数据源、mysql、oracle)的配置方法。 一、对Mondrian的介绍(引用官方的介绍):     Mondrian is an OLAP (online analytical processing) database written